Description
Usurfacemesh
USurfaceMesh
USurfaceMesh
This plugin can build procedural custom static meshes from within the editor that project onto any mesh or landscape with smooth blending so it looks like it is part of your existing scene. It can also capture the surface height to a mesh or texture.
USurfaceMesh is a versatile and powerful asset for developers using the popular Unreal Engine. It is a tool that allows for the creation and manipulation of meshes within the engine, giving developers the ability to create complex and detailed surfaces for their games and applications. With USurfaceMesh, developers can easily import and export meshes, as well as modify and sculpt them to fit their specific needs. This asset is particularly useful for those working on open-world games, as it allows for the creation of expansive and detailed environments with ease.
A grid based multipurpose tool that creates terrain blended rock and cliffs, captures height and auto paints vertex colors
The USurfaceMesh plugin was built to create custom fit static meshes that fit anywhere. You can project the mesh to the surface of any other mesh or landscape and then customize it with various height textures. The plugin allows you to stamp the mesh to the surface and then recreate it if you want to change the mesh further. It also allows for easily capturing the height of the surface below and rendering various data out as render target textures which can then be utilized repeatedly throughout the plugin to produce multiple variations. Easily interchange textures to customize the height as well as height noises and height detail textures that layer up height data together. It can also mask and flatten the mesh using textures and using the included settings.
Note: The advert images above show assets from the Quixel library for Unreal. Any material can be used to paint the static meshes which this plugin can build.
This is an ‘Editor Only’ plugin. It can create meshes while inside the Unreal Editor.
Version 1.3 Features
- Warp the mesh along a spline
- The Apply to Landscape feature can now use surface data to paint the landscape layers
- Improved world aligned texture sampling to displace the mesh. This now matches the world aligned texture nodes in an Unreal Engine material.
- Added a new tool called USurfaceMeshEdit which has mesh editing features (Currently to remove polygons that are hidden from view. Can be used on any static mesh)
Erosion (Water and Thermal), Apply to Landscape, FlowMap generator, Edge/Height using curves and UI improvements
NEW FEATURE: A new USurfaceMeshPaint tool was also added that can use mesh surface data to either paint vertex colors or render out to a texture. This tool can be used on ANY static mesh.
Version 1.1 Features:
Vector Displacement Textures, World Aligned Texture Option, Presets, Vertical Warp and Selectable Removal
Technical Details
Features:
- Create a grid mesh from any height texture
- Create custom rocks, cliffs and mud mounds
- Create water bodies that autofill their container
- Project on to any other mesh
- Remove polygons that are not needed
- Attach multiple surface meshes together
- Capture the surface height of any other surface
- High poly to low poly conversion from surface data
- Create meshes with curves
- Full Landscape material with layers
- Full Mesh material with layers
Materials use the Albedo+NormalMap+RDA packed channel workflow (Option to switch to single channel textures)
Content:
70 Height Textures (Rocks, Cliffs, Mud Mounds, Crater, Face, Creature)
25 Height Noise Textures (For variation)
12 Vector Displacement Maps
11 Base Materials
3 MatCap Materials
4 Water Material Instances
1 Lava Material
1 Underwater Post Process Material
1 Caustic Decal Material
6 Texture Sets (Grass, Rock, Dirt)
4 Static Meshes (Rock, Face and Grass)
6 Material Functions
5 Visualization Material Instances (Vertex Color etc)
1 Spline Mesh Blueprint
Code Modules:
USurfaceMeshGrid & Paint
Number of Blueprints: 1
Number of C++ Classes: 1
Network Replicated: N/A
Supported Development Platforms: Win64
Supported Target Build Platforms: All
Documentation: http://www.3devsoftware.com/support/unreal/usurfacemesh/docs
Example Project: https://drive.google.com/file/d/1EGkxYzIF_iUNHFDDfIiZmYyZuI42-joK/view?usp=sharing
Important/Additional Notes: Editor only plugin. Creates regular static meshes once stamped into the level.
USurfaceMesh
Usurfacemesh
Ue3dFree 10.000+ Unreal Engine Assets
Realistic Environments with Usurfacemesh: Your Ultimate Unreal Engine Library
Are you tired of generic, lifeless environments in your Unreal Engine projects? Do you crave the power to craft truly immersive and believable worlds, brimming with detail and realism? Then look no further than **Usurfacemesh**, the revolutionary Unreal Engine environment library designed to transform your projects from ordinary to extraordinary. **Usurfacemesh** empowers you to effortlessly create stunning landscapes, intricate interiors, and believable environments that will captivate your audience.
**:** A Game Changer for Environment Artists
**** isn’t just another asset pack; it’s a comprehensive collection of meticulously crafted high-quality assets, optimized for performance and designed for seamless integration into your Unreal Engine workflows. Forget tedious modeling and texturing; **** delivers pre-built, ready-to-use assets that save you valuable time and resources, allowing you to focus on what truly matters: creating compelling gameplay and narrative experiences.
This powerful library includes a vast array of assets, including:
* **High-Resolution Textures:** Experience unparalleled visual fidelity with our stunning collection of high-resolution textures, meticulously crafted to capture the nuances of real-world materials. From weathered stone to gleaming metal, **** provides the textures you need to bring your vision to life.
* **Detailed Models:** Our library features an extensive collection of detailed 3D models, ranging from intricate architectural elements to realistic natural formations. Every model in **** is optimized for performance, ensuring smooth frame rates even in the most demanding scenes.
* **Modular Components:** Build complex and unique environments with ease using our modular components. Mix and match different elements to create limitless variations, adapting to any projects specific needs. ****’s modular design ensures flexibility and scalability for any project, big or small.
* **Pre-built Environments:** Short on time? **** includes a selection of pre-built environments, complete with lighting, materials, and post-processing effects. These ready-to-use environments provide a fantastic starting point for your projects, allowing you to jump right into gameplay development.
* **Optimized for Performance:** We understand the importance of performance in game development. Every asset in **** is meticulously optimized to ensure smooth frame rates, even on lower-end hardware. This means you can create visually stunning environments without sacrificing performance.
**Why Choose ?**
The benefits of using **** are numerous:
* **Save Time and Resources:** Spend less time on tedious asset creation and more time on what truly matters: gameplay, storytelling, and polish. **** drastically reduces development time, allowing you to meet deadlines and stay on budget.
* **Enhanced Realism:** Create truly immersive and believable environments with our high-quality assets and realistic textures. **** will elevate your projects to a new level of visual fidelity.
* **Seamless Integration:** Our assets are designed for seamless integration into your existing Unreal Engine projects. **** is compatible with all major Unreal Engine versions and features a user-friendly interface.
* **Unmatched Versatility:** **** is suitable for a wide range of projects, from small indie games to large-scale AAA titles. The modular design and diverse asset selection ensure adaptability to any projects specific needs.
* **Regular Updates and Support:** We are committed to providing ongoing support and regular updates for ****. This ensures that you always have access to the latest features, bug fixes, and performance improvements.
**:** The Key to Unlocking Your Creative Potential
**** is more than just a library of assets; it’s a tool that empowers you to unlock your creative potential and bring your visionary environments to life. Whether you’re a seasoned game developer or just starting out, **** provides the resources you need to create stunning and immersive worlds. Forget limitations; with ****, the only limit is your imagination.
**:** Real-World Applications
**** is incredibly versatile and can be used in a wide range of projects, including:
* **First-Person Shooters (FPS):** Create realistic and engaging environments for your FPS games, from detailed urban landscapes to sprawling natural settings. **** provides the assets you need to build believable and immersive worlds.
* **Role-Playing Games (RPG):** Craft captivating fantasy worlds or realistic medieval settings with ****. Our detailed models and textures bring your RPG worlds to life, enhancing immersion and storytelling.
* **Real-Time Strategy (RTS):** Build detailed and strategic battlefields using ****’s modular components and pre-built environments. The optimized assets ensure smooth performance, even with large numbers of units on screen.
* **Architectural Visualization:** Showcase your architectural designs with stunning realism using ****. Our high-quality assets provide the detail needed to create compelling visualizations for clients and stakeholders.
* **Virtual Reality (VR) and Augmented Reality (AR):** Immerse your users in breathtaking VR and AR experiences with ****’s realistic environments. The optimized assets ensure smooth performance and a seamless user experience.
**:** The Future of Environment Creation
**** represents the future of environment creation in Unreal Engine. Our commitment to quality, performance, and user experience sets us apart from the competition. We are constantly striving to improve and expand ****, adding new assets and features to keep up with the ever-evolving needs of game developers.
Don’t settle for generic environments. Choose **** and your creative potential. Transform your Unreal Engine projects from ordinary to extraordinary with the power of ****. Download **** today and experience the difference! Experience the unparalleled realism and efficiency that **** offers. Start creating breathtaking environments with **** now! **** is your ultimate solution for realistic and immersive game environments. Upgrade your Unreal Engine projects with ****.